Speaking to reporters after QP yesterday, Bob Rae identifies what he is not.
Reporter: What do you make of McGuinty proroguing Parliament or the Legislature?
Rae: Well, I mean I’m not going to get into a daily commentary on events in the Ontario Legislature. The Premier will make his decisions. Opposition parties will make their own decision.
Reporter: But a lot of Liberals actually slammed the Harper government when they prorogued Parliament so why doesn’t that apply in this case?
Rae: Because I’m not a daily commentator on the events in the Ontario Legislature.
